Introduction

Energy regulation and public administration are closely connected because the energy sector depends on government institutions, regulatory agencies, public utilities, and administrative decision-making. Traditionally, energy regulation focused on electricity tariffs, licensing, and infrastructure development. However, the modern energy transition has created new governance challenges involving renewable energy, climate change, digital technologies, market liberalization, energy security, public participation, and regulatory accountability.

Frontier issues in energy regulation and public administration concern how governments design, implement, monitor, and enforce energy policies while maintaining transparency, efficiency, fairness, and public trust. These issues require balancing economic growth, environmental protection, social welfare, and national security objectives.

Meaning of Energy Regulation and Public Administration

Energy regulation refers to the legal and institutional framework governing the production, transmission, distribution, and consumption of energy resources. It includes:

Licensing and permitting

Tariff determination

Market oversight

Competition regulation

Environmental compliance

Consumer protection

Public administration refers to the management and implementation of public policies through government agencies, ministries, regulatory commissions, and public institutions.

The interaction between energy regulation and public administration is critical because regulatory agencies implement governmental energy policies while remaining accountable to the public. Independent regulators have become central to modern electricity governance. Studies of India's electricity reforms show that stronger regulatory institutions improve sector performance and efficiency. (IDEAS/RePEc)

Major Frontier Issues

1. Regulatory Independence Versus Political Control

One of the biggest challenges is maintaining the independence of energy regulators while ensuring democratic accountability.

Governments often seek to influence tariff decisions, subsidy policies, and market interventions. Excessive political interference may undermine investor confidence and market stability.

Independent regulatory commissions are expected to:

Make evidence-based decisions

Protect consumers

Ensure fair competition

Promote long-term energy planning

The challenge is preventing regulators from becoming either politically controlled or completely insulated from public accountability.

Case Law

PTC India Ltd. v. Central Electricity Regulatory Commission (2010) 4 SCC 603

The Supreme Court recognized the broad regulatory powers of electricity regulators and emphasized their independent role in implementing the Electricity Act.

West Bengal Electricity Regulatory Commission v. CESC Ltd. (2002) 8 SCC 715

The Court emphasized that regulatory commissions perform specialized public functions and should exercise powers independently.

2. Energy Transition Governance

Governments worldwide are transitioning from fossil fuels to renewable energy.

Public administrators must manage:

Coal phase-outs

Renewable integration

Green hydrogen policies

Energy storage deployment

Just transition programs

The challenge is coordinating multiple agencies and stakeholders while minimizing social and economic disruptions.

Administrative systems designed for conventional energy often struggle to regulate decentralized renewable systems and emerging technologies.

3. Regulatory Capacity and Technical Expertise

Modern energy systems involve:

Artificial intelligence

Smart grids

Battery storage

Carbon markets

Digital energy trading

Regulatory agencies often lack the technical expertise needed to supervise these innovations effectively.

Administrative capacity-building has therefore become a frontier governance issue. Government policies increasingly emphasize the need for skilled regulatory personnel, institutional training, and financial autonomy for regulatory commissions. (Indian Kanoon)

4. Transparency and Public Participation

Modern energy governance increasingly requires public engagement.

Communities demand participation in decisions involving:

Renewable energy projects

Transmission lines

Hydropower facilities

Carbon capture projects

Nuclear facilities

Public administration must ensure:

Access to information

Meaningful consultation

Environmental disclosure

Public hearings

Failure to provide participation opportunities may create social conflict and litigation.

Case Law

M.K. Ranjitsinh v. Union of India (2024)

The Supreme Court emphasized balancing renewable energy development with biodiversity protection, highlighting the importance of informed and transparent decision-making in public administration.

5. Regulatory Coordination Across Agencies

Energy governance increasingly involves multiple institutions:

Energy ministries

Environmental agencies

Competition authorities

Financial regulators

Climate authorities

Local governments

Fragmented authority often causes:

Delays

Conflicting regulations

Jurisdictional disputes

Administrative inefficiencies

Improving inter-agency coordination has become a key frontier issue.

6. Climate Governance Integration

Energy regulators are increasingly expected to consider climate objectives.

Traditional regulatory frameworks focused on:

Reliability

Affordability

Economic efficiency

Today, regulators must also consider:

Emission reductions

Climate resilience

Decarbonization targets

Sustainability indicators

This transformation requires significant changes in public administration practices.

7. Digitalization and Data Governance

Energy systems now generate enormous volumes of data through:

Smart meters

Digital platforms

Automated dispatch systems

Distributed energy resources

Key governance concerns include:

Data ownership

Privacy protection

Cybersecurity

Algorithmic accountability

Regulators must develop new administrative tools to oversee digital energy systems.

8. Regulatory Accountability

Independent regulators exercise substantial public power.

Therefore, accountability mechanisms are essential.

These include:

Judicial review

Legislative oversight

Public reporting

Performance audits

Appeals mechanisms

The challenge is maintaining accountability without compromising regulatory independence.

Case Law

India Energy Exchange Ltd. v. Central Electricity Regulatory Commission (2026)

The Appellate Tribunal discussed distinctions between regulatory rule-making and administrative decision-making, emphasizing the legal standards governing regulatory actions. The decision highlights accountability requirements in modern energy governance. (Indian Kanoon)

9. Energy Justice and Equity

Energy regulation increasingly focuses on fairness and social inclusion.

Important issues include:

Energy poverty

Rural electrification

Affordable tariffs

Indigenous rights

Gender equity

Vulnerable consumer protection

Public administrators must ensure that energy transition benefits are distributed equitably.

10. Public Trust and Institutional Legitimacy

The success of energy policies depends heavily on public trust.

Citizens must trust that regulators:

Act impartially

Follow legal procedures

Consider public interests

Prevent corruption

Loss of institutional legitimacy can delay infrastructure projects and weaken compliance.

The concept of public trust has become central to energy governance, especially in natural resource management and public-interest decision-making. (vLex)

Important Case Laws

1. PTC India Ltd. v. Central Electricity Regulatory Commission (2010) 4 SCC 603

Principle: Regulatory commissions possess extensive rule-making powers and play a central role in energy governance.

Significance: Established the constitutional and administrative importance of independent regulators.

2. West Bengal Electricity Regulatory Commission v. CESC Ltd. (2002) 8 SCC 715

Principle: Regulatory bodies must function independently while serving public-interest objectives.

Significance: Foundational case on electricity regulation in India.

3. Sesa Sterlite Ltd. v. Orissa Electricity Regulatory Commission (2014) 8 SCC 444

Principle: Electricity regulation requires balancing consumer interests with financial sustainability.

Significance: Reinforced the role of regulators in maintaining market fairness.

4. M.K. Ranjitsinh v. Union of India (2024)

Principle: Renewable energy expansion must be reconciled with environmental and biodiversity obligations.

Significance: Demonstrates integration of climate governance and administrative law.

5. India Energy Exchange Ltd. v. Central Electricity Regulatory Commission (2026)

Principle: Clarified distinctions between legislative and administrative functions of regulators.

Significance: Important for understanding regulatory accountability and procedural fairness. (Indian Kanoon)

6. Global Energy Ltd. v. CERC (2009)

Principle: Regulatory actions must promote accountability, transparency, and rational decision-making.

Significance: Highlights constitutional limits on regulatory discretion. (Indian Kanoon)

Emerging Future Trends

Future energy regulation and public administration are likely to focus on:

Artificial intelligence governance

Climate-risk regulation

Green hydrogen markets

Cross-border electricity trade

Energy cybersecurity

Decentralized energy governance

Carbon accounting systems

Digital regulatory platforms

Real-time market supervision

Just transition administration

Institutions such as specialized regulators and tribunals are becoming increasingly important in managing the legal complexities of the energy transition. Research on India's Appellate Tribunal for Electricity (APTEL) highlights its growing role in shaping the legal architecture of the energy transition. (ORA)

Conclusion

Frontier issues in energy regulation and public administration reflect the transformation of energy systems from centralized, fossil-fuel-based models to decentralized, digital, and low-carbon systems. Regulators and public administrators must address challenges involving independence, accountability, technological innovation, climate governance, public participation, energy justice, and institutional legitimacy. Courts worldwide, particularly in India, have played a crucial role in defining the powers and responsibilities of energy regulators. As the global energy transition accelerates, effective public administration and adaptive regulatory governance will become indispensable for achieving energy security, sustainability, and public welfare.
